Output d628929107f5204f275528d46b27dac9086b40cc63c3d0226383a88ddc7964bd:1

value
37000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bbb217a2f8354ef3acdbb76fe250ed20da0a055 OP_EQUALVERIFY OP_CHECKSIG
address
14zEEKiD7RE3FCRpLWS7tSEqD8gh4ERsUq
transaction
d628929107f5204f275528d46b27dac9086b40cc63c3d0226383a88ddc7964bd
spent
true